My wife and I flew into Glasgow last July from Vancouver, Canada. There was a considerable line at the passport control, but it still took only about 20-25 minutes to get through. It might have been quicker had I not made the mistake of answering the question about purpose of the visit by revealing that I was in Scotland to play with a pipe band. This admission seemed to arouse suspicions that I might be getting paid for my services (I wish!) and led to a rather rigorous questioning on the subject. Customs was no problem; we just walked through.
